Its features include debugging support, syntax highlighting, intelligent code completion, snippets, code refactoring, and embedded Git. Visual Studio Code, also known as VS Code, is a lightweight and open source code editor developed by Microsoft. IDEs are software applications that provide a complete set of tools and functionalities to make the development of computer programs, software applications, and websites easier. Additionally, the dev community is continuously creating Integrated Development Environments (IDEs) and IDE extensions to enhance the development process of React Native applications. This framework is known for its thriving community, a wide range of libraries and frameworks, and the availability of component libraries that support native features.Īll these features make it easier for developers to work with React Native and improve their overall development experience. Since its initial release in 2015, React Native has gained significant popularity as a framework for developing apps that work on multiple platforms.
